Transaction 9106987bbb4f13e658ca95fcae1253b67f4534e83e8e2ce0180f707395811b4c

2 Input
2 Outputs
  • 9106987bbb4f13e658ca95fcae1253b67f4534e83e8e2ce0180f707395811b4c:0
  • value  93264
    address  13d62bBABK3deFGi9PgUUXdEzEu9SPFUNr
  • 9106987bbb4f13e658ca95fcae1253b67f4534e83e8e2ce0180f707395811b4c:1
  • value  4670000
    address  1P5vQpF69BWzLijXZskV5Ena58oUmHPgFC